Likewise, Is Vallejo on a fault line? The new Napa Quadrangle and revised Cuttings Wharf Quadrangle maps cover the West Napa Fault Zone, which extends from the Vallejo area northwards, where the fault zone borders the east side of Napa Valley, officials said.

Is Vallejo considered Bay Area?

Vallejo is a waterfront city in Solano County, California, located in the North Bay subregion of the San Francisco Bay Area. Vallejo is geographically the closest North Bay city to the inner East Bay, so it is sometimes associated with that region. Its population was 115,942 at the 2010 census.
